What is Machine Learning?
We can define Machine Learning as a subset of artificial intelligence that has turned out to be in great demand in recent times. It allows applications to be more precise when it comes to predicting outcomes. In other words, it allows the users to feed a computer algorithm and make it analyzed.
When corrections are found, the algorithm then incorporates that information and makes use of the updated one. This helps in improving the nature of decision-making in the future. Basically, machine learning models identify patterns, make decisions with no or little intervention from humans.

Merlin Project
The latest version of the Merlin Project is very well done. The Mac version of Microsoft Project looks very similar and gives you fine-grained control over creating project plans, which many other options overlook.
Create tasks and subtasks with dependencies and constraints, add work content and duration separately, assign resources with options to shorten or increase the period and how much work each resource does. You can check if you have appointed and add your fields to each task to define the field types (checkboxes, dates, etc.). The Merlin Project also includes great new features such as Kanban board, resource pool, and mind map, and the Apple App Store also offers standalone apps.
Tom’s Planner
Tom’s Planner is a paid web-based Gantt chart software that allows anyone to quickly drag and drop Gantt charts to collaborate and share online. Tom’s Planner is a more manageable and collaborative Microsoft project alternative, but it’s expected to substitute teams seeking to cooperate with Excel. In conclusion, there is no approach to define dependencies or non-working hours (bank holidays, etc.), giving the impression of MS Excel.
However, if you want to create a simple project plan, I think it’s pretty good. Web-based, very intuitive, and easy to use. Another prominent feature is adding links to other websites and online documents, and embed your schedule on your blog, website, or intranet. The actual business feature here is that you can share and collaborate online, but the downside is that it’s fundamental.

Why Choose Drupal Over WordPress: A Comprehensive Comparison
In the realm of content management systems (CMS), two platforms stand out as leaders: Drupal and WordPress. Both are powerful tools with their own strengths and weaknesses, but choosing the right one for your project is crucial. In this article, we will delve into the reasons why you might want to consider Drupal over WordPress for certain use cases.
I. Scalability and Flexibility:
One of the primary reasons why developers and enterprises prefer Drupal over WordPress is its scalability and flexibility. Drupal is designed to handle complex and large-scale websites seamlessly. Its modular architecture allows developers to create highly customized solutions tailored to specific business needs.
Unlike WordPress, which is initially geared towards blogging and small to medium-sized websites, Drupal’s architecture is more robust. This makes it suitable for building anything from personal blogs to enterprise-level applications. Drupal’s flexibility is particularly advantageous for businesses with evolving needs and those planning substantial growth.
II. Content Modeling and Data Architecture:
Drupal excels in content modeling and data architecture, providing a sophisticated framework for organizing and categorizing content. It allows users to create and manage content types with fields, providing a high level of customization. This feature is especially beneficial for websites with intricate content structures or those requiring extensive data relationships.
WordPress, on the other hand, is more straightforward in terms of content management. While it’s user-friendly and great for beginners, it may become limiting when dealing with complex data structures. Drupal’s robust content modeling capabilities make it an ideal choice for organizations with specific content requirements.
III. Security Features:
Security is a paramount concern for any website, and Drupal has a strong reputation for its security features. Drupal’s community actively monitors and addresses security issues promptly. Its core code is designed with security in mind, and the platform provides a range of tools and modules to enhance site security.
WordPress, being the most widely used CMS, is also a frequent target for hackers. While the WordPress community is diligent about releasing security updates, the sheer number of plugins and themes available introduces potential vulnerabilities. Drupal’s emphasis on security and its proactive community make it a preferred choice for organizations that prioritize safeguarding their digital assets.
IV. Performance and Speed:
Drupal is often praised for its performance and speed, especially when compared to WordPress. The way Drupal handles caching, its optimized codebase, and the ability to fine-tune performance settings make it an excellent choice for websites that demand high-speed loading times.
WordPress, while efficient for smaller websites, can become resource-intensive as the site grows. Drupal’s architecture, with its focus on performance optimization, makes it a go-to option for projects where speed is a critical factor, such as e-commerce sites or media-heavy platforms.
V. Community and Support:
Both Drupal and WordPress boast large and active communities, but the nature of their communities differs. Drupal’s community is known for its strong collaboration on complex projects and its commitment to open-source principles. The community actively contributes to the platform’s development, ensuring continuous improvement.
WordPress, with its massive user base, is excellent for finding solutions to common issues and for accessing a vast repository of plugins and themes. However, for more specialized or complex projects, Drupal’s community-driven approach often provides more tailored support and expertise.
VI. Customization and Theming:
Drupal’s theming system offers a high level of flexibility and control over the visual presentation of a website. With the Twig templating engine and a well-defined theme layer, developers can create highly customized and responsive designs. This level of control is particularly advantageous for businesses with unique branding requirements.
While WordPress has a robust theming system as well, Drupal’s theming capabilities shine when it comes to intricate and customized designs. The ability to control every aspect of the theme makes Drupal a preferred choice for designers and developers looking to create visually stunning and unique websites.
VII. Internationalization and Multilingual Support:
For websites catering to a global audience, Drupal’s internationalization and multilingual support are key features. Drupal’s core functionality includes built-in support for multiple languages, allowing content creators to easily manage translations and present content in different languages.
While WordPress does support multilingual plugins, Drupal’s native support for internationalization simplifies the process, making it more efficient for organizations with a diverse audience.
